Understanding the Fahrenheit and Celsius Scales



Before diving into the conversion, it's important to understand the underlying principles of each scale. The Fahrenheit scale, developed by Daniel Gabriel Fahrenheit, uses the freezing point of water as 32°F and the boiling point as 212°F. The Celsius scale, also known as the centigrade scale, sets the freezing point of water at 0°C and the boiling point at 100°C. The key difference lies in the size of the degree increments: a degree Celsius is larger than a degree Fahrenheit. This difference necessitates a conversion formula.

The Conversion Formula: From Fahrenheit to Celsius



The formula for converting Fahrenheit to Celsius is:

°C = (°F - 32) × 5/9

This formula takes the Fahrenheit temperature, subtracts 32 (to account for the difference in freezing points), and then multiplies the result by 5/9 (to adjust for the different degree sizes).

Step-by-Step Conversion of 220°F to Celsius



Let's apply this formula to convert 220°F to Celsius:

Step 1: Subtract 32 from the Fahrenheit temperature:

220°F - 32°F = 188°F

Step 2: Multiply the result by 5/9:

188°F × 5/9 ≈ 104.44°C

Therefore, 220°F is approximately equal to 104.44°C.

Common Challenges and Troubleshooting



While the conversion formula is straightforward, some common challenges can arise:

Order of Operations: It's crucial to follow the order of operations (PEMDAS/BODMAS). Subtraction must be performed before multiplication.
Fractions and Decimals: The use of the fraction 5/9 often leads to decimal answers. It's important to understand that these decimals represent fractional degrees Celsius.
Negative Temperatures: The formula works perfectly for negative Fahrenheit temperatures as well. Remember to perform the subtraction before the multiplication. For example, converting -4°F to Celsius would be: (-4 - 32) × 5/9 = -20°C

4. Why is the conversion factor 5/9? This factor accounts for the different sizes of degrees between the Fahrenheit and Celsius scales. There are 180 degrees between the freezing and boiling points of water in Fahrenheit (212°F - 32°F = 180°F), and 100 degrees in Celsius (100°C - 0°C = 100°C). The ratio 180/100 simplifies to 9/5, and its reciprocal 5/9 is used in the Fahrenheit-to-Celsius conversion.
